Sauter, officially known as Sauter Automation, is a leading player in the building management systems industry, headquartered in RS. Founded in 1910, the company has established a strong presence across Europe, particularly in the Balkans, where it has become synonymous with innovative solutions for energy efficiency and automation. Sauter’s core offerings include advanced building management systems, energy management solutions, and smart building technologies, all designed to optimise operational efficiency and sustainability. The carbon intensity of the energy grid powering a company's primary operations has a strong influence on its overall carbon footprint. This request for Sauter is in RS, which has a very high grid carbon intensity relative to other regions.
